Abstract

An in-situ dendritic crystalline α-La reinforced bulk metallic glass matrix composite was successfully synthesized by chill casting a La66Al14Cu10Ni10 alloy into copper mould with a rod diameter as large as 12 mm in diameter. The critical cooling rates for the formation of the in-situ composite determined by Bridgman solidification and for complete glass formation are 15 K/s and 450 K/s respectively. The thermal stability of the residual amorphous in the composite is higher than that of the fully amorphous sample of the same alloy.
